Governance Model

Pax adopts a decentralized governance model, ensuring that no single entity has absolute control. Governance is divided into the following components:

1. Community Governance (DAO-Like Model)

A governance framework will be established where token holders can participate in key decisions through on-chain voting. Governance will be structured as follows:

  • Pax Improvement Proposals (PIPs): Community members can submit PIPs, which will be reviewed, discussed, and voted on.

  • Voting Mechanism: Token-weighted voting, where staked Pax tokens grant governance power.

  • Proposal Categories:

    • Protocol upgrades

    • Economic adjustments (e.g., staking rewards, token burns)

    • Ecosystem growth initiatives

2. Validator & Node Governance

Validators and node operators play a critical role in network security and consensus. Governance aspects include:

  • Staking Requirements: Minimum stake amount for validators.

  • Consensus Participation: Rules for participating in Proof of Stake & Proof of History consensus.

  • Slashing & Rewards: Penalties for malicious behavior and incentives for honest validators.

3. Foundation & Advisory Role

While Pax aims for full decentralization, an initial Pax Movement will oversee governance development, ensuring:

  • Fair distribution of governance power.

  • Transparent execution of proposals.

  • Development of tools for community-led governance.
